Transaction abf7240cbebb85fb3225441c5a936c93d5350331fe76e3a5dcef7f8285e8099e
1 Input
2 Outputs
- abf7240cbebb85fb3225441c5a936c93d5350331fe76e3a5dcef7f8285e8099e:0
- abf7240cbebb85fb3225441c5a936c93d5350331fe76e3a5dcef7f8285e8099e:1
value 245833
address 3NghX5vMFVNF59LXeH7YKubYkzjsepyRr5
value 3210546
address 1BKqvXENiCsDLTasZsiUEtkYjHuUTWL6Q9